Taiwan Ports Corporation continues to build a family-friendly workplace and has once again received external recognition. This year, the company won three prestigious parenting-related awards from Taipei City: the 'Outstanding Parenting-Friendly Enterprise' award for the second time, along with two category awards for 'Parenting and Family Support Networks and Measures' and 'Forward-Looking and Innovative Initiatives.' On August 14, at the '2024 Taipei City Parenting-Friendly Enterprise Awards Ceremony and Family Day Event,' Executive Vice President Kao Chuan-Kai led the team to accept the awards, affirming the company's long-term commitment to implementing family-friendly policies and supporting employees in balancing their careers and caregiving responsibilities.
Facing declining birth rates and increasingly diverse family care needs, Taiwan Ports Corporation consistently upholds its 'people-first' philosophy, integrating parenting support as a key strategy for talent sustainability. Through systemic reforms, resource allocation, and cultural initiatives, the company fosters a workplace where employees feel confident getting married, willing to have children, and secure in raising them—enabling work-life integration at every life stage.
In terms of childcare support, the company has established workplace-based cooperative childcare centers in Keelung, Taichung, and Kaohsiung, providing educational and caregiving services for children aged 2 to 6. These are complemented by flexible working hours, remote work options, parental and family care leave policies that exceed statutory requirements, and diverse support measures to alleviate employees' caregiving burdens.
The award for 'Parenting and Family Support Networks and Measures' recognizes the company's ongoing efforts to build a comprehensive parental support system. Beyond offering parenting consultations and resources, the company facilitates knowledge-sharing platforms and peer exchanges, enabling employees to receive tangible support and gradually establishing a robust childcare support network.
Beyond policies and benefits, Taiwan Ports Corporation views managerial support as a critical driver in deepening a family-friendly culture. In recent years, it has continuously promoted a 'Managerial Support Initiative,' conducting executive roundtables, workshops, and union dialogues to enhance understanding among managers at all levels regarding employees' parenting and caregiving needs, thereby integrating family-friendly values into daily management practices.
The company emphasizes that only when managers genuinely understand and support employees' family needs can a psychologically safe and inclusive workplace be cultivated. To this end, it encourages managers and staff to co-create a supportive environment through family-oriented activities, Family Days, and innovative programs.
